WebWe collect the CFS instead of an IRS Form W-8BEN or Form W-8BEN-E to help establish an accountholder/payee’s non-U.S. tax status. The CFS is generally valid for three years. Before expiration, we proactively contact accountholders/payees through email and account notification when their CFS needs to be recertified. Business Tax Application Instructions; … WebThe tax certificate represents a lien on unpaid real estate properties. Interest accrues on the tax certificate from June 1 until the taxes are paid. The amount of the certificate is the sum of the unpaid real estate tax, non-ad valorem assessments, penalties, advertising costs, and fees. This year, the Tax Certificate Sale will be on June 1st.
